| Legwand, Predators upend Blackhawks |
David Legwand's marker early in the second period proved to be the winner, as the Nashville Predators clipped the Chicago Blackhawks 4-1 in Game 3 of their Western Conference quarterfinals series on Tuesday night. Nashville cashed as +120 home underdogs, while the game resulted in a PUSH on the 5-goal total set by oddsmakers. Legwand also had two assists for the Predators, who got a pair of helpers from Steve Sullivan in the win. Tomas Kopecky netted the lone tally for Chicago, which now trails Nashville 2-1 in the best-of-seven series. |
